You will need:
1 pint of cherry tomatoes, halved 11 oz of spinach 1 zucchini, sliced 5 pieces of sundried tomato, sliced 1 red onion, medium chopped 8 leaves of basil chopped 1 pint of mushrooms, sliced half a lemon season to taste (we used a mix of dehydrated garlic, sea salt and other spices) 8 servings of fussili pasta and 1 tablespoon of olive oil!
Saute onions and mushrooms with a bit of salt seasoning for 5 minutes.
Add zucchini and cover till soft.
Once pasta is cooked, add it to the cooked veggies and add the cherry tomatoes and spinach.
When the spinach is wilted, add sun dried tomatoes, olive oil, basil, season to taste and drizzle with lemon.
Eat with Siracha!! The heat really brightens up the flavour.
